Notebook: Bigby pushed by Smith for starting safety's job

"gbguy20" wrote:



Also taken from the article

"The Packers are optimistic Bigby will come around, even if his numbers two solo tackles in roughly six preseason quarters suggest he has a ways to go.

Smith, meanwhile, has been one of the preseason standouts, registering eight solo tackles, a sack, two interceptions and five passes defended in extended time with the No. 2 defense, plus 2 series with the starters on Friday at Arizona after Bigby left with a sprained thumb.

Smith was visible in practice again on Monday, intercepting starting quarterback Aaron Rodgers twice and almost getting a third. He also took a 2-minute series with the starters, although Bigby said that was only because he told Smith to take his place."

I like bigby ... but smith is showing things that I really enjoy ... whom doesnt like sacks, interceptions and a hard hitting safety? ... used to love collins hits last year on receivers - now we get another hard hitting safety.

It seems highly unlikely that the Packers will cut Smith, especially if Tom Pelissero has him 'pushing for the starting job.' With Rouse's injury at safety cutting Smith would leave the only healthy back-ups as Charlie Peprah and Jarrett Bush. Regardless of Attitude I'm sure the Packers would rather have a mouthy Smith back there than the perpetually ineffective Bush and Peprah.
